UI Health Care has Iowa’s largest team of board-certified urogynecologists. Our faculty are nationally recognized experts who strive to train the future of academic leaders in urogynecology and reconstructive pelvic surgery, who will advance healthcare through excellence in clinical care and scientific research.
The Urogynecology and Reconstructive Pelvic Surgery Fellowship at the University of Iowa Health Care Medical Center is a three-year, ACGME-accredited program that trains obstetrician-gynecologists to provide consultative services and comprehensive surgical and non-surgical management of pelvic floor disorders, including urinary incontinence, other lower urinary tract disorders, pelvic organ prolapse and childbirth-related injuries.
Our program has a longstanding close relationship with the Department of Urology, including multidisciplinary clinical care and shared research efforts going back over 20 years.
Our fellowship includes five core faculty members, with three from Urogynecology (OB/Gyn) and two from our Department of Urology. Our core faculty actively participate in our fellowship teaching which occurs in the clinical setting, through didactics, journal club, conferences, staffing, grand rounds, and mentor meetings.
Applications are accepted through ERAS. We currently match residents trained in obstetrics & gynecology.
